首页>>前端>>Vue->ts笔记?

ts笔记?

时间:2023-12-21 本站 点击:0

TypeScript继承&多继承笔记

1、面向对象的三大特性:封装、继承、多态。TypeScript面向对象,类 (class)static关键字,表示一个静态属性,通过类访问。readonly关键字,表示一个只读属性,不能修改属性,构造函数可初始化。

2、从历史包袱角度说JavaScript的包袱是前向兼容,即使老版本的ES中有落后的方面,为了兼容,也要支持,而TypeScript宣称完全兼容JavaScript,这导致了TypeScript继承了JavaScript一切的缺点,所以从这点上看可以说是不相伯仲。

3、TypeScript是一种由微软开发的自由和开源的编程语言。它是JavaScript的一个超集,而且本质上向这个语言添加了可选的静态类型和基于类的面向对象编程。

4、在TypeScript 新的版本中,TypeScript会对元组做越界判断。超出规定个数的元素称作越界元素,元素赋值必须类型和个数都对应,不能超出定义的元素个数。

vue3特性笔记

1、综上所述,在 vue3 的初始化项目中,与 vue2 对比的最大差异其实就是两点:setup 函数也是 Composition API 的入口函数,我们的变量、方法都是在该函数里定义的,不再使用vue2中的data而是setup。

2、toRef和toRefs可以理解为给 一个响应式对象 的一个或多个 属性创建ref对象 。ref的值会和响应式对象的值保持同步。 区别就是toRef是创建一个,toRefs是一下创建多个。

3、最近项目正在优化。乘着有时间看了一下 vue-cli0.x 使用 。感觉还蛮不错的。

4、过渡的类名 在进入/离开的过渡中,会有 6 个 class 切换。

5、使用Vite搭建Vue的TypeScript版本的时候,可以使用 Vite自带的模板预设 —— vue-ts 。

【笔记】使用Vite搭建Vue3(TypeScript版本)项目

1、使用Vite搭建Vue的TypeScript版本的时候,可以使用 Vite自带的模板预设 —— vue-ts 。

2、另外,Vue3支持 Typescript 语法编程也是其中一大亮点,为了 探索 新技术的工程化搭建,本文会把Typescript、vite、pinia等官方周边整合到工程里面。

3、搭建vite项目的命令。我的目前是115,升级一下:目前是0 新建vite项目命令行:输入y即可。

4、Vite 是一个 web 开发构建工具,由于其原生 ES 模块导入方式,可以实现闪电般的冷服务器启动。使用 Vite 可以快速构建 Vue 项目。 Vite 需要 Node.js版本 10以上。

5、这篇文章主要介绍了在Vue组件中使用 TypeScript的方法,需要的朋友可以参考下注意:此文并不是把vue改为全部替换为ts,而是可以在原来的项目中植入ts文件,目前只是实践阶段,向ts转化过程中的过渡。


本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若转载,请注明出处:/Vue/47883.html